Maglieri Michele MikeMAGLIERI, Michele 'Mike' - It is with great sadness that we announce the passing of our beloved Michele on Monday August 16, 2021 at the age of 86 years. Michele passed peacefully while he was surrounded by his loving family.

Michele is now reunited in heaven with his dear parents Margherita and Cristino Maglieri.

He was the beloved husband of Santina (Tina). Cherished father of Margherita Maglieri and her husband Noel A. Nolasco DaSilva and Christian and his wife Cristina Bertoia Maglieri. Mike was the devoted Nonno of Matteo, Mauro and Lia.

Mike was truly a remarkable man with many passions and interests. His top priority always being his family. He would worry about his children and grandchildren endlessly. He has an avid member of the Exceptional Nonno Society of Canada, where all grandchildren are adored loved and spoiled. Mike loved his garden and would often be found outside tending to it. He was well known for his homemade pasta and wine.

The family wishes to extend their heartfelt gratitude to all their family and friends for the outpouring of concern and love throughout this past year. A special thanks to Dr. Humaira Saeed of William Osler Palliative Care Clinic, Nurses Laura and Humaira and PSW’s Arleen and Janet for their care and compassion.

Mike will be deeply missed and fondly remembered by all his family, friends and all who knew him.

Arrangements and livestream funeral details are entrusted with Scott Funeral Home “Brampton” Chapel. In consideration of the vulnerable, the family requests that only family and friends that are fully vaccinated attend at the visitation or funeral service.

In keeping with Mike’s wishes Private Cremation to take place. Mike’s ashes will be laid to rest at a later date.

In lieu of flowers, donations in loving memory of Mike to the Hospital for Sick Children or the Toronto General Hospital Cardiac Unit would be greatly appreciated by the family.
